5-Day Easter Island Tour
Travel to Easter Island, also known as Rapa Nui, and spend five days visiting some of its best-known archaeological sites and coastal settings. The island lies in the Pacific Ocean, more than 3,700 km from the Chilean mainland, and is home to one of the world’s most concentrated collections of moai and ceremonial remains. This package includes time in Hanga Roa, guided visits to Rano Raraku, Anakena, Orongo, Rano Kau, Ana Te Pahu and other key sites, plus a free day to slow down and explore at your own pace. Hanga Roa
Arrival in Easter Island and Hanga Roa
Arrive at Mataveri Airport, meet your transfer, and settle into your hotel. The rest of the afternoon is free. Hanga Roa town and the Tahai area by the coast are both easy first-day options for a relaxed walk. - 2
Rano Raraku Volcano
Rano Raraku, Tongariki and Anakena
Spend the day visiting key sites linked to the island’s moai tradition, including Ahu Akahanga, Rano Raraku, Ahu Tongariki, Te Pito Kura, Ahu Nau Nau and Anakena Beach. Rano Raraku is the main quarry site, while Tongariki is known for its long platform and restored statues.Breakfast, lunch - 3
Orongo
Orongo, Rano Kau and Ana Te Pahu
Visit the ceremonial village of Orongo and the crater of Rano Kau, then continue to Ana Te Pahu and other archaeological points included in the day’s route. This is a good day for understanding the island’s ritual history and its volcanic landscape.Breakfast
